Came here to try their halo-halo after lunch, they had no ice and it didn’t seem like they were in any rush to get anymore. Quite an odd experience especially it’s in the business name, you’d think they would have plenty of ice in-stock or at least try and get more especially on a hot summer day (I visited on a Sunday, typically one of the more busier days of the week). I’m sure it taste fine, but from what other reviews are saying, I’d probably skip this if you’re just here for the halo halo and opt for somewhere else (or call ahead to make sure they have ice). Otherwise, food looks like typical Filipino flair, quite a small location situated at the food court. Limited seating, interesting attractions (dinosaur exhibit + a live band performance).
